Stop the Meeting Overload

Well, your mini-break in Marbella may have been out of this world, but it was also shorter than the time you’ve spent in meetings this year. Don’t believe us? A recent study found that on average, we spend up to 26 days (most people only get 20-25 days of holiday per year!) in meetings.

